What To Look For Before Buying Brightening Eye Cream

Skin type

Just like any other skincare product, eye creams may have special formulations for different skin types. Identify whether you have dry, oily, sensitive, or combination skin, and choose a cream that will complement it. This will ensure the product will work with your skin’s natural balance and target your unique concerns.

Ingredients

The brightening eye cream’s ingredients will determine its overall effectiveness. Look for brightening ingredients like vitamin C, niacinamide, and kojic acid to combat dark circles. To reduce puffiness, seek out caffeine, green tea extract, aloe, or even cucumber. If fine lines and wrinkles are your concern, opt for creams with retinol, peptides, or hyaluronic acid. Always be sure to read the label and avoid products containing harmful chemicals or artificial fragrances, especially if you have sensitive skin.

Consistency

The area around your eyes is delicate, and a heavy cream might cause irritation, milia, or acne. Try to choose a lightweight, fast-absorbing formula, such as a gel or serum, that won’t weigh down your skin or cause unwanted side effects. If you have dry or more mature skin, a thicker cream may be better.

Packaging

Exposure to air and light can cause some active ingredients to degrade or lose their potency. Look for eye creams packaged in opaque, air-tight containers, which will help maintain the product’s effectiveness.

Q: What’s the difference between a brightening eye cream and a regular eye cream?

A: Brightening eye creams and regular eye creams serve different purposes. Brightening eye creams are specifically formulated to target dark circles, uneven skin tone, and pigmentation around the eye area. They usually contain ingredients such as vitamin C, niacinamide, and other lightening agents to help brighten and even out the skin tone. Regular eye creams, on the other hand, focus more on more on daily hydration. They often contain ingredients like hyaluronic acid, peptides, and antioxidants to nourish and protect the delicate skin around the eyes.

Advertisement

Q: How do I use brightening eye cream?

A: To use a brightening eye cream, you should start by cleansing your face and patting it dry. After applying any serums or treatments you use in your skincare routine, gently dab a small amount of the brightening eye cream onto your ring finger. Apply the cream in a tapping motion along the orbital bone, avoiding direct contact with the eye. Begin at the inner corner of the eye and work your way outward, making sure to cover the entire area where dark circles and pigmentation are present. Allow the cream to fully absorb before applying any other products, such as moisturizer, sunscreen, or makeup. Keep in mind that it’s important to use the cream consistently for the best results.

Q: Should I use brightening eye cream in the morning or at night?

A: You can use many brightening eye creams both in the morning and at night. However, it’s essential to consider the specific product and its ingredients. If the brightening eye cream contains ingredients that make the skin more sensitive to sunlight, such as retinol or certain acids, it’s better to use it at night. If the product contains antioxidants and sunscreen, it’s typically more suitable for daytime use.

Q: How soon will I see the results of my brightening eye cream?

A: The time it takes to see results can vary depending on the product, your skin type, and your concerns. Generally, it can take anywhere from a few weeks to a couple of months to see noticeable improvements in the appearance of dark circles and pigmentation. Consistency is key, so make sure to use the brightening eye cream as directed for best results.

Advertisement

Q: Should I apply my brightening eye cream before or after sunscreen?

A: You should apply your eye cream before applying sunscreen. This allows the eye cream to fully absorb into the skin and provide its benefits. After the eye cream fully absorbs, follow up with a broad-spectrum, eye-safe sunscreen to protect your skin from harmful UV rays.

What the Michael Biopic Means for Every Indie Filmmaker

Published

on

The Michael Jackson biopic Michael is more than celebrity drama; it is a real-time lesson in how legal decisions can quietly rewrite a story that millions of people will see. You do not need a $200M budget for the same forces—contracts, settlements, and rights issues—to shape or even erase key parts of your own work.

“The Michael Jackson Movie Is A HUGE HIT!” by Adam Does Movies, CC BY, via YouTube.

What Happened to Michael

The film Michael originally included a third act that addressed the 1993 child sexual abuse allegations and their impact on Jackson’s life and career. Trade reports say this version showed investigators at Neverland Ranch and dramatized the scandal as a turning point in the story. After cameras rolled, lawyers for the Jackson estate realized there was a clause in the settlement with accuser Jordan Chandler that barred any depiction or mention of him in a movie.

Because of that old agreement, the filmmakers had to remove all references to Chandler and rework the ending so the story stopped years earlier, in the late 1980s at Jackson’s commercial peak.

According to reporting, this meant roughly 22 days of reshoots, costing around 10–15 million dollars and pushing the total budget over 200 million.

Meanwhile, actress Kat Graham confirmed her portrayal of Diana Ross was cut for “legal considerations,” showing how likeness and approval issues can wipe out an entire character even after filming.

For audiences, the result is a movie that intentionally avoids one of the most controversial chapters of Jackson’s life, which some critics argue makes the portrait feel incomplete or selectively curated.

Advertisement

The Hidden Power of Contracts and Rights

The key detail in the Michael story is that a contract signed decades ago could dictate what present-day filmmakers are allowed to show. That settlement clause did not just affect the people who signed it; it effectively controlled the narrative of a big-budget film made years later. This is how legal documents become invisible co-authors: they quietly set boundaries around what your story can and cannot include.

Creators face similar invisible lines with:

  • Life-rights and defamation: If you dramatize real people, especially in a negative light, they can claim defamation or invasion of privacy if your portrayal is inaccurate or harmful.
  • Copyright and trademarks: Unlicensed music, clips, logos, or artwork can trigger copyright or trademark claims that block distribution or force expensive changes.
  • Distribution contracts: Some deals give distributors the right to re-edit, retitle, or repackage your work without your approval unless you negotiate otherwise.

Legal commentary warns that fictionalizing real events and people carries heightened risk because audiences tend to connect your dramatization back to actual individuals. That risk does not disappear just because you are “small” or “indie”; impact, not audience size, usually determines exposure.


Why This Matters for Indie Filmmakers and Creators

Independent filmmakers often choose the indie route precisely to maintain creative control, but they can face more risk if they skip legal planning. Common problems include unclear ownership of the script, missing music licenses, handshake agreements with collaborators, and no written permission to use locations or people’s likenesses. These are the kinds of issues that can derail distribution, block a streaming deal, or force last-minute cuts that fundamentally change your story.

Legal guides for indie filmmakers consistently emphasize a few realities:

  • You do not fully “own” your film unless you have clear contracts for writing, directing, producing, and underlying rights.
  • Unregistered or unlicensed creative elements (like music and logos) can make your project uninsurable or unattractive to distributors.
  • Fixing legal problems after the fact is almost always more expensive and limiting than planning for them at the beginning.

So when you watch Michael skip over certain events, you are seeing, in exaggerated form, the same forces that can shape an indie short, web series, documentary, or podcast episode.


You do not need a law degree, but you do need a basic legal strategy for your creative work. Here are practical steps drawn from entertainment-law and indie-film resources:

  1. Clarify who owns the story
    • Use written agreements with co-writers, directors, and producers that state who owns the script and finished film.
    • If your work is based on a real person or memoir, secure life-rights or written permission where appropriate, especially if the portrayal is sensitive.
  2. Be intentional with real people and events
    • When telling true or inspired-by-true stories, avoid making specific, negative claims about identifiable people unless they are well-documented and legally vetted.
    • Change names, details, and circumstances enough that the person is not clearly identifiable if you do not have their cooperation.
  3. Lock down music and visuals
    • Use original scores, licensed tracks, or reputable libraries; never assume you can keep a song just because it is in a rough cut.
    • Clear artwork, logos, and recognizable brands, or replace them with generic or custom-designed alternatives.

  1. Protect yourself in contracts
    • When signing any distribution or platform deal, read the clauses about editing, retitling, and marketing carefully; ask for limits or at least consultation rights.
    • Include terms that let you reclaim rights if a partner fails to release the work, goes dark, or breaches key promises.
  2. Document everything
    • Keep organized copies of releases, licenses, and contracts; these documents are part of your project’s value and proof of your rights.
    • Register your work where applicable (for example, copyright), which strengthens your ability to enforce your rights if someone copies you.

Education-focused legal resources repeatedly stress that preventative steps—basic contracts, clear permissions, and simple registrations—are far cheaper than dealing with takedowns, lawsuits, or forced rewrites later.


The Big Takeaway: Story and Law Are Connected

The Michael biopic illustrates what happens when legal obligations and creative vision collide: whole characters disappear, endings are rewritten, and the public only sees a version of the story that fits within old contracts.
